These two tables give required flue sizes vs input BTUH for heating appliances vented through a metal B-vent chimney (Table C-9-B) or through a masonry chimney (Table C-9-C). The rule of thumb for sizing a chimney liner is that you never want it to be smaller than the appliance exhaust hole and you don&39;t want the liner to be three times the area of the exhaust hole of the appliance. A chimney made of concrete blocks and ceramic flue tiles uses a special type of block that is sized and shaped differently than the 8-by-8-by-16 inch blocks found in concrete block walls.
